192 MILES HOME (J4x48) Sq.Set Katy Sweetman RSCDS Book 50
(All turns with Elbow Grip - RE=Right Elbow, LE=Left Elbow)

Part A
1- 8 1s nearer hands joined dance between 3s, separate, cast into centre and dance out between 2s/4s back to place (1M between 2s, 1L between 4s)
9-16 1s turn RE, turn corners LE, 1s turn RE, 1M+2M also 1L+4L turn LE
17-24 1s turn RE, 1M+3L also 1L+3M turn LE. 1s dance to original places facing out, set and turn inwards to face partner

Part B
1- 4 Men pass LSh dancing to Right into next Lady's place, face out while Ladies cast to partner's place and face in. All turn corner (dancer on Left) LE to finish nearer hands joined with corner facing in
5- 8 All advance with corner and Men Retire with Lady on Left
9-12 Ladies pass LSh dancing to Right into next Lady's place, face out while Men cast to next Man's place and face in. All turn corner (dancer on Left) LE to finish nearer hands joined with corner facing in
13-16 All advance with corner and Men Retire with partner to new position (1 place round anticlockwise)
17-24 All circle 8H round and back

Note: bars 1-2 and 9-10 of Part B resemble 2 bars of Schiehallion Reel

(MINICRIB. Dance crib compiled by Charles Upton, Deeside Caledonian Society, and his successors)

Dance Information

This jig, 192 Miles Home, was devised by Katy Sweetman from the Brighton Branch in October 2014 and was written while the deviser was travelling the 192 miles from South Wales back to her home city, Brighton and Hove.
